1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Appellate Jurisdiction
Back
The authority of some courts to review decisions made by lower courts
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Civil Law
Back
This is a group of laws that refer to disputes between people
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Common Law
Back
This is a type of law that comes from judges decisions that rely on common sense and previous cases
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Concurring Opinion
Back
A statement written by a supreme court justice who agrees with the majorities opinion but for different reasons
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Constitutional Law
Back
This is a type of law that is based on the constitution and on supreme court rulings on the constitution
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Criminal Law
Back
This is a group of laws that describes crime
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Dissenting Opinion
Back
A statement written by a supreme court justice who disagrees with the majorities opinion
